Description

The aircraft maintance course gives aviation technicians clear, structured, and practical training in essential maintenance skills. The program starts by explaining the core ideas behind aircraft maintenance and shows how proper procedures improve safety and reliability. From the first module, participants understand why the aircraft maintance course plays a key role in building strong technical competence.

The curriculum follows ICAO and EASA expectations. It covers aircraft structures, engines, avionics, hydraulics, landing gear, fuel systems, and electrical components. Each module uses simple language and real maintenance examples. This approach helps technicians connect theory with daily tasks and understand how each system works.

The aircraft maintance course also offers type-specific learning. Participants review aircraft manuals, manufacturer instructions, and certification requirements. This material teaches them how to work confidently with different aircraft types and how to follow official procedures during maintenance operations.

Hands-on training forms a major part of the program. Participants use tools, test equipment, and diagnostic methods. They practice inspections, minor repairs, troubleshooting, and component checks. These activities build practical confidence and improve decision-making in real operational conditions.

The course also highlights human factors, safety culture, and documentation. Trainees learn how to prevent maintenance errors and how proper reporting supports continuous airworthiness. They also see how quality procedures guide safe maintenance work.

At the end of the aircraft maintance course, participants can perform maintenance tasks more accurately and efficiently. They understand international standards and can support airlines, MROs, and maintenance organizations. The course suits new technicians and current staff who want to improve their technical skills and advance their aviation careers.

Key Topics

The course includes theoretical knowledge, type-specific training, and practical skills development:

1. Basic Aircraft Maintenance Training (EASA Part-66/FAA aligned)

Modules 1–17, including:

  • Mathematics, Physics, Electrical & Electronic Fundamentals
  • Maintenance Practices, Human Factors, Aviation Legislation
  • Aircraft Structures & Systems (Fixed and Rotary Wing)
  • Engine Types (Gas Turbine, Piston), Propellers

2. Aircraft Type Rating Training (Specific to aircraft model)

  • Aircraft systems familiarization
  • Engine types (e.g., CFM56, Trent 700)
  • Maintenance procedures and avionics overview
  • Simulator or on-aircraft practical sessions

3. Practical Training

  • Hands-on exercises in real hangar environments
  • Troubleshooting and fault diagnosis
  • Component removal and installation
  • Safety practices and regulatory compliance

Objectives

  • This intensive, competency-based course is designed to:
  • Develop a highly skilled and certified aircraft maintenance workforce.
  • Ensure participants are qualified to perform and certify maintenance tasks in accordance with international standards.
  • Equip professionals with up-to-date technical knowledge and hands-on experience.
  • Align with ICAO’s Manual on Training of Aircraft Maintenance Personnel (Doc 10098) through detailed training needs analysis.
